I'm adding a similar spectral series for the proms on the SW limb. Won't post an animation as I need to use a different computer (with Photoshop) to save the gif properly in continuous looping mode. I think that's the problem, anyway.
An interesting observation about this spectral series is that it's "lopsided". The proms are much more prevalent on the blue side of H alpha line centre, indicating that the prom plasma we are seeing has a predominant line of sight velocity approaching us. The filament has roughly the same visibility on both sides of line centre indicating that it's quiescent.

Re: SHG 1st light of 2016: AR12529 in H alpha
Vincent;
It's my usual instrument but I've added a x2 photographic tele-extender (Komura Telemore) in combination with a 300mmfl telephoto for the camera lens to give more magnification in the image. The configuration here is then: 600mmfl camera lens, 500mmfl collimator lens and 1000mmfl telescope objective (Astro Rubinar catadioptric). This gives a system focal length of 1200mmfl but, with a 25micron slit, it also projects a slit image of 30 microns width (7px) on the camera sensor. I should really go to a smaller slit width for this configuration and plan to use 10 microns next time.
Ultimately, I would like to go to a longer focal length telescope ... the ideal way to magnify the image scale. I've tried the x2 tele-extender on the Astro-Rubinar for 2000mmf but the image was definitely too soft.
It looks like your new SHG will allow some "mix and match" of various camera lenses. I think this will give you some great flexibility to achieve a desired result.

Vincent;
I agree that you might have trouble with a zoom lens. They are generally of lower optical quality than fixed focal length lenses. You can probably put together a good selection of fixed focal length lenses relatively cheaply by watching eBay.
Yes, I do use a uv-ir cut filter (Schneider True Cut) in front of the objective. Here's a photo:
